New Delhi, Dec 16 (PTI) Coriander prices on Monday fell by Rs 42 to Rs 6,498 per quintal in futures trade as speculators reduced their positions amid weak demand in spot market.

On the Multi Commodity Exchange, coriander contracts for January fell by Rs 42, or 0.64 per cent, to Rs 6,498 per quintal in 8,200 lots.

Similarly, coriander contracts for April delivery declined by Rs 46, or 0.67 per cent, to Rs 6,800 per quintal in 4,120 lots.

Market analysts said subdued demand by speculators in spot market mainly led to decline in coriander futures' prices.
